Foundation Pier Repair in Columbus, OH
Foundation pier rep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ation by installing or replacing support piers beneath the structure. These projects typically involve stabilizing sagging or uneven floors, addressing cracks in basement walls, or preventing further settling caused by soil movement. Homeowners often seek this service when signs of foundation shifting become noticeable, such as cracks, sticking doors, or uneven flooring, and want to understand the best approach to restore safety and stability to their property.
Before requesting foundation pier repair, property owners should consider the extent of foundation movement, the underlying causes, and the types of piers suitable for their specific foundation type. It's important to evaluate whether the issue is isolated or widespread, and to understand the potential impact on the property's value and safety. Gathering information about the repair process, potential costs, and how the work may affect daily use can help homeowners make informed decisions about addressing foundation concerns effectively.

Foundation Pier Repair Questions
What are foundation pier repairs? Foundation pier repairs involve installing supports beneath a building’s foundation to stabilize and lift it, preventing further damage.
When is foundation pier repair needed? Repair may be necessary if signs like uneven floors, cracked walls, or sticking doors are present, indicating foundation movement.
What types of foundation piers are used? Common types include helical piers and push piers, selected based on soil conditions and foundation needs.
How does a property owner know if repair is required? Visible cracks, uneven flooring, or doors that don’t close properly can signal foundation issues needing assessment and repair.
